Coconut Vibes is our Vibes imperial stout recipe infused three times with raw and toasted coconut flakes (because we can’t fit all of it on one try!) and a dash of cocoa nibs from Ghana. For this release we also blended in roughly 18% barrel-aged imperial stout which was aged for 21 months in Willett bourbon barrels to elevate the base beer for the coconut to integrate into.

Look - Pours a pitch black color with a super dark brown head that quickly dissipates.
Smell - Coconut and chocolate. Simple but nice.
Taste - A nice coconut and chocolate flavor. Not sweet, but not bitter either.
Feel - A very thick, creamy mouthfeel that goes so well with the coconut and chocolate flavor. Perfect.
Overall - This is one my favorite non-barrel aged stouts. At least, I'm not tasting the barrel aging, and the bottle says nothing about it, but the current BeerAdvocate description says it "was aged for 21 months in Willett bourbon barrels"?

L - Deep motor oil black with a dark tan head that dissipates relatively quickly, leaving behind a thin cap and minor lacing.
S - Sweet, milky coconut and fudge - smells like unsweetened coconut milk, which doesn't necessarily smell great, but it smells like it should with the ingredients
T - Sweet milky coconut up front and throughout intermixed well with fudge and bakers chocolate - very faint notes of bourbon. As it warms, some of the toasted coconut shines through
F - Full bodied with light carbonation - soft, velvety smooth, oily slick
O - Pretty straight forward - like a silky smooth mounds bar - tons of rich chocolate and coconut - very well done, yet simple. The only thing that could be better is the smell

Appearance - The stout poured a velvety black color with much of the carbonation suffocated.
Smell - The nose was sweet with notes of coconut and chocolate.
Taste - At the front were notes of sweet, milky coconut. This was followed by a strong chocolate presence. It was like a Mounds bar, but better. There was no bitterness. The chocolate lingered longest into the aftertaste.
Mouthfeel - The body was thick allowing the profile to linger for an extended period.
Overall - I liked it a lot.

Black with no light penetration. There's a fingernail of brown around the rim and a third of the top. The aroma is of chocolate and coconut, like a Mounds bar. I'm tasting coconut, dark chocolate, and black licorice. The mouth is very thick and viscous. The alcohol is well hidden.
